July 4th Events for Nutley !!!

 

 

Nutley's upcoming July 4th celebration will continue the town's tradition with morning games for youngsters and a festive fire-works display over the Park Oval at night.

The morning activities will include the "Firecracker Competition for kids ages 12 and under".  Registration is scheduled at 9 a.m. with games starting at 9:30 a.m and continuing until 12 noon.

Games include a potato sack race, ball throws, running races and many other fun activities. Participants will be receiving ribbons and free Italian ice and top finishers will receive medals in the following categories: 4 and under, 5 and 6 year olds, 7 to 9 year olds, and 10 to 12 year olds.

Evening festivities begin with Franklin Avenue Street closing from Church to Chestnut Street at 6 p.m.. On hand will be local bands as well as DJ John Gizzi from Slipped Disc Inc. providing music and games in the Oval. Food vendors will be on site for the evening event.

Seating in the Oval will be limited but lawn chairs and blankets can be used along Franklin Avenue and Chestnut Street.

In the event of inclement weather, the fireworks will be rescheduled for the next clear night. Information on possible postponement will be available at www.nutleynj.org .
